PAG LIN 1 1 SENATE FILE 277 1 2 1 3 AN ACT 1 4 RELATING TO HOSPITAL CLINICAL PRIVILEGES OF A PHYSICIAN 1 5 ASSISTANT OR ADVANCED REGISTERED NURSE PRACTITIONER. 1 6 1 7 BE IT ENACTED BY TH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F THE STATE OF IOWA: 1 8 1 9 Section 1. Section 135B.7, unnumbered paragraph 2, Code 1 10 1999, is amended to read as follows: 1 11 The rules shall state that a hospital shall not deny 1 12 clinical privileges to physicians and surgeons, podiatric 1 13 physicians, osteopaths, osteopathic surgeons, dentists,or1 14 certified health service providers in psychology, physician 1 15 assistants, or advanced registered nurse practitioners 1 16 licensed under chapter 148, 148C, 149, 150, 150A, 152, or 153, 1 17 or section 154B.7, solely by reason of the license held by the 1 18 practitioner or solely by reason of the school or institution 1 19 in which the practitioner received medical schooling or 1 20 postgraduate training if the medical schooling or postgraduate 1 21 training was accredited by an organization recognized by the 1 22 council on postsecondary accreditation or an accrediting group 1 23 recognized by the United States department of education. A 1 24 hospital may establish procedures for interaction between a 1 25 patient and a practitioner.Nothing in theThe rules shall 1 26 not prohibit a hospital from limiting, restricting, or 1 27 revoking clinical privileges of a practitioner for violation 1 28 of hospital rules, regulations, or procedures established 1 29 under this paragraph, when applied in good faith and in a 1 30 nondiscriminatory manner.Nothing in thisThis paragraph 1 31 shall not require a hospital to expand the hospital's current 1 32 scope of service delivery solely to offer the services of a 1 33 class of providers not currently providing services at the 1 34 hospital.Nothing in thisThis section shall not be construed 1 35 to require a hospital to establish rules which are 2 1 inconsistent with the scope of practice established for 2 2 licensure of practitioners to whom this paragraph applies. 2 3 This section shall not be construed to authorize the denial of 2 4 clinical privileges to a practitioner or class of 2 5 practitioners solely because a hospital has as employees of 2 6 the hospital identically licensed practitioners providing the 2 7 same or similar services. 2 8 2 9 2 10 2 11 MARY E.
